Job Summary
Under direction of the Director of the Provincial Oncology Drug Program, the Drug Access Navigator (DAN) will be responsible for the facilitation and coordination of patient access programs. The coordination will be required with other members of the multidisciplinary team: medical oncologists, hematologists, pharmacists, pharmacy assistants, nurses and social workers.
Working with the pharmacy team this position may also ensure that record keeping is performed, and maintain adequate drug inventory.
Note: The successful candidate will be working with hazardous materials on a daily basis.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) and training are provided. Primary working hours are Monday to Friday day shifts.
